    In 1918, Masataka Taketsuru embarked alone to embark on a long journey to Scotland.

    In this remote land the secrets of whiskey making were taught to this young Japanese man, who in Scotland also met the woman who would become his wife.

    Masataka Taketsuru was born in the coastal town of Takehara (then known as Takehara City) about 60 km from the city of Hirosima.

    The Taketsuru family owned a distillery of "Sake" (rice liqueur) from 1733 (which continues to process this drink to this day).

    Sake making is a fine art, for which Masataka studied up to graduate in Chemistry at the University, in order to prepare to run the family business.

    Despite this, the Scotch Whiskey captured the young man's imagination, who decided to dedicate his life to this liqueur. Having the opportunity to go to Scotland, Masataka enrolled at the University of Glasgow, becoming the first Japanese to study the art of whiskey making.

    He took chemistry classes at university, learning in the field to distill in distilleries, observing workers, receiving training as a blender.

    At the end of his studies, Masataka finally managed to reach the degree of Master Blender.

    In 1920 Masataka returned to Japan, in the company of Jessie Roberta (Rita), with whom he had married a year earlier. After arriving at his company, he set out to develop a genuine whiskey, which eventually led to the birth of the first Japanese Whiskey. Masataka's vision was formed thanks to his experience of him in Scotland: he immediately understood that an optimal environment was essential to produce a good whiskey.

    In 1934, Masataka founded Nikka Whiskey, building his first distillery in Yoichi, Hokkaido, which despite its inexpensive location is the best place to make Japanese Whiskey, as it was similar to many Scottish towns where he had studied.

    For decades, his company has been developing and creating whiskey in Japan, while maintaining his passion for quality.
